### Step 4 — Broker upgrade (Quillbus 3.x)

Drain the old Quillbus brokers before switching consumers. Do not skip the drain; in-flight messages will be dropped otherwise. Upgrade one node at a time, verify replication catches up, then advance the cluster protocol version. Rollback is only possible before the protocol bump. Apply the 3.x settings exactly as shown below.

service settings:
PRAIX_LOG_LEVEL=error
PRAIX_METRICS_HOST=metrics.praix.qorvelcorp.corp
PRAIX_POOL_SIZE=16

- [ ] Note the mail room move. As of this month, the Kestrelworks mail room has relocated from the ground floor to Level 2, beside the Larchview meeting suite. All incoming parcels and internal post are now handled there between 09:00 and 16:30. On your first day, drop by to register your name with the post team so deliveries reach your desk. The Level 2 door is kept locked outside staffed hours, so you'll need the code below to get in.

staff pass of kawip-hawef = bdg-QLP-2

## Step 4: Verify feature parity

Before switching from the Lathe SDK to the Coppice SDK, confirm both clients expose identical behavior. Run the parity harness against the Wrenfield sandbox; it diffs retry handling, pagination, and event ordering. Any mismatch blocks migration — file it against the Coppice board, don't patch locally. The harness needs both clients pointed at the same endpoint. Configure it with the following values.

deployment values, yahag-tawef:
ZORWYN_HOST=zorwyn.tolvaqlabs.internal
ZORWYN_PORT=9300